Why is B wrong?
B says:that plastic can be made electrically conductive—this advance leading
Generally speaking, whenthis (ademonstrative pronoun ) refers to somethingwithin the sentence itself, it is almost always incorrect. For example, in this case,this advance is referring to a fact already mentionedwithin the sentence : that plastic can be made electrically conductive.
